在Python中使用urllib2加速获取页面可以通过以下步骤实现:
- 导入urllib2模块:在Python中,可以使用urllib2模块来发送HTTP请求和获取页面内容。首先需要导入该模块。
- 创建请求对象:使用urllib2.Request()函数创建一个请求对象,并指定要访问的URL。
url = "http://example.com"
request = urllib2.Request(url)
- 发送请求并获取页面内容:使用urllib2.urlopen()函数发送请求并获取页面内容。可以将返回的响应对象保存到一个变量中。
response = urllib2.urlopen(request)
- 读取页面内容:通过调用响应对象的read()方法,可以读取页面的内容。
page_content = response.read()
- 关闭连接:在完成页面内容的读取后,应该关闭连接,释放资源。
使用上述步骤,可以在Python中使用urllib2加速获取页面。urllib2是Python标准库中的一个模块,用于处理HTTP请求和响应。它提供了丰富的功能,包括发送请求、处理重定向、处理Cookie等。
优势:
- 简单易用:urllib2模块提供了简单易用的接口,使得发送HTTP请求和获取页面内容变得简单快捷。
- 内置功能丰富:urllib2模块内置了处理重定向、处理Cookie等功能,可以满足大部分的页面获取需求。
- 可扩展性强:urllib2模块可以与其他Python库和框架结合使用,实现更复杂的功能。
应用场景:
- 网络爬虫:urllib2模块可以用于编写网络爬虫,快速获取网页内容。
- 数据采集:通过urllib2模块可以获取网页中的数据,用于数据采集和分析。
- API调用:使用urllib2模块可以发送HTTP请求,调用各种API接口。
推荐的腾讯云相关产品和产品介绍链接地址: